Typical Service Disruption Upon Exchange Failure

When a telephone exchange (Central Office, or CO) becomes unusable for any reason, the landline phones connected to it typically experience a service outage. This is because landline phones rely on the local exchange to route calls. The CO acts as a central hub, directing traffic and ensuring that calls are properly connected. If the exchange is down, the calls cannot be processed, leading to service disruption.

Redundancy Systems: Mitigating Service Disruption

In some networks, redundancy systems are in place to minimize service disruption. If one exchange fails, calls can be rerouted through another exchange. This approach depends on the specific infrastructure and technology used by the service provider. Redundancy systems can significantly enhance reliability and provide a backup solution in case of a primary exchange failure.

Real-World Scenarios and Limitations

While advanced technologies offer possibilities for rerouting calls, there are practical limitations. In some cases, the service provider may not have the necessary infrastructure or redundancy in place to facilitate rerouting. Additionally, certain jurisdictions, like Australia, have experienced situations where bushfires have affected both landline and cellular networks, leading to widespread service outages.

Another factor to consider is the nature of the outage. If the problem is localized and only affects a single office (inter-office issues), the phones within the same office may still be able to communicate, but calls to other offices would fail. This underscores the importance of robust network design and management.

Historical Context: The Manual Telephone Exchange System

The historical context is also important in understanding the evolution of telecommunications. In the early days of telephone communication, calls were manually routed by operators. Each telephone line connected to a local exchange, where an operator would manually initiate and complete calls by connecting the wires to the appropriate line. If the operator was unavailable or the exchange system was down, manual intervention was required to establish the connection.

The introduction of automatic systems resolved many of these issues. Today, the reliance on automated systems and redundancy technologies significantly enhances the reliability and resilience of telecommunications networks. However, the legacy of manual telephone exchange systems serves as a reminder of the complexity and challenges faced in early telecommunication infrastructure.
